DIURNAL VARIATION OF BLOOD PRESSURE IN PATIENTS WITH TYPE 2 DIABETES MELLITUS WITH CARDIOVASCULAR AUTONOMIC NEUROPATHY

We examined 80 pat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us. All patients underwent Holter ECG monitoring. Based on this data, patients were divided into two groups: DAN (-) and DAN (+). All patients underwent 24-hour blood pressure monitoring. The time index of systolic and diastolic blood pressure, as well as the variability of systolic and diastolic blood pressure, were higher in the DAN (+) group. A time index greater than 20% was found in 75% of pat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us and DAN (+).
